LIVING THE REVOLUTION OF EMPOWERMENT

Every now and then I look back at my time in the disability movement--I was 16--I was in an unused airplane hanger--and a vet listening to an "expert" tell some people with disabilities what should be in the regs for Section 504--stood up and said Bull shi#!! 

That was a week or two ago. 

Now I look at the words of Justin Dart and I think we are doing things but can still be guided by what was said-- so I put these words in the blog today.

I propose that we of the disability community lead the revolution of empowerment...[this] is not empty rhetoric. There is a distinct and vital difference between society/government that empowers people, and a society/government that provides for them and regulates them for their own good...empowerment is when government joins with business, labor, religion, and individual citizens to guarantee every person the tool to govern, to produce and [to] live the best life possible for self and for all...we [PWDs] have unique knowledge and experience to offer. We have the responsibility to lead. Justin Dart Mainstream Magazine 1998

We must keep leading the revolution of empowerment!! Lead ON.
